Review: 
5 piece debut that bridges the soundscapes of traditional acoustic folk and new age sonic ambiance, the band has successfully created a fresh branch of music which falls somewhere between The Fleet Foxes or The Avett Brothers and DIIV or Beach Fossils (beatroute mag). Name of band is a reference to he 1822, General William Ashley that hired 100 men to explore the Missouri river source. Music is influenced by old school folk to progressive rock to modern electronic.
